The optimization of vertical bifacial photovoltaic farms for efficient

Relative yields for PV energy and crops are similar for the vertical bi-E / W and mono-N / S PV when the panel density is half (p / h = 4) of that of the standard PV farms. For standard p / h = 2 or denser PV arrays, bi- E / W results in a higher crop yield at the cost of reduced energy yield.

Photovoltaic systems with vertically mounted bifacial PV

The meter reading was read periodically and evaluated for a period of one year (11th August 2017–10th August 2018). The specific energy yield of the 9.09 kWp vertical bifacial PV system in this period is 942 kWh/kWp. A typical value for south-facing PV systems in the same region is 1000 kWh/kWp (Baumann et al., 2018).

Solar Empowers Rural Afghanistan

The primary activity was the installation of photovoltaic systems for villages in 21 Afghan provinces. Some of the provinces were quite dangerous. In a few instances, work crews were kidnapped by Taliban or jailed by corrupt local authorities, but all were fortunately released unharmed. Some PV systems in the south experienced theft or sabotage.

Analysis of solar photovoltaic and wind power potential in Afghanistan

In this paper we analyze the potential for large-scale grid-connected solar photovoltaic (PV) and wind power plants in two of Afghanistan''s most populous provinces (Balkh and Herat) to meet a large fraction of growing electricity demand.

Solar Empowers Rural Afghanistan

This helped improve the overall quality and reliability of PV systems. Many earlier PV systems deployed in Afghanistan had experienced widespread failures due to poor design and installation practices. MRRD had installed over 100,000 PV home systems, almost all of which had early failures to the point that MRRD had banned the use of PV systems
